Output 3e647a007ad6913fdc18030fd48425f7ba2b53521a66749f613fc79452dcffed:9

value
1127825863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2d4ecec37af3832bda2caf01bc7a932ffbd99fa OP_EQUAL
address
3HzbH1c4T1Q5jH2yK4fzyT2m4p173jNGmx
transaction
3e647a007ad6913fdc18030fd48425f7ba2b53521a66749f613fc79452dcffed
confirmations
252958
spent
true